Explore a great lower Manhattan hotel in SoHo, convenient to New York University and the West Village. At the Courtyard New York Manhattan/SoHo Hotel, youll find a lobby with inviting spaces to work or relax in, easy access to the latest news, weather and airport info via the GoBoard, and Table 181 SoHo Café, with healthy food and beverage options in the morning and light fare with beer and wine in the evenings. Our guest rooms feature contemporary, modern design, plush bedding, and complimentary wireless Internet access. Some rooms even offer views of the Statue of Liberty and NYCs beautiful skyline. The Courtyard SoHo Hotel is near Greenwich Village, Little Italy, Chinatown and Canal Street, 10 miles from LaGuardia Airport and 12 miles from Newark Airport. We offer a well-equipped fitness center; a 24-hour business center and boarding pass printing area. Houston St. and Spring Street metro stations are also nearby. I'd stay again.

Weekend couple getaway was very pleasant. Walked to Soho shops, dining, bars, lounges, and clubs. Arrived in NYC via bus (Port Authority). One easy subway ride (the #1 train) landed us at the doorstep of the hotel. Varick St had enough traffic so that cabs were easy to get, also. 14th Floor room was VERY quiet and pleasant (and the elevator was spacious, fast and not "scary" like some elevators are).

Excellent place and location!

First - the location is amazing. Step outside and walk for hours - SOHO is non-stop. Little Italy, China Town like at mile away - Subway across the street - LOVED the location! I am giving it a 5 because it fit our needs perfectly. A girlfriend and I went on vacation - requested and got 2 double beds, room was clean as can be - AC worked wonderfully. Basically - the people at the desk are also well versed on the area - and were spot on with their recommendations and directions. Starbucks coffee ready for us in the a.m. - fresh as can be. It's not one of those overly crowded places where u bump into people everywhere. It's quaint, clean, very friendly. Rooms were cleaned as they should be - we had a no so good view but weren't there for a view and hardly were in our rooms long enough to enjoy it. I honestly do not have a negative thing to say about this place. Cab from JFK - expect $60-$65bucks (before tip). Great area to be in if you are experiencing NY for the first time as we were -

Great Stay

We stayed here on a quick trip to NYC for some wedding planning. The location is great, unless its rush hour. Then it can become kind of a nightmare if you have to drive because of the traffic going into the Holland Tunnel. However, I would strongly recommend public transportation anyway. You can catch the 1 just around the corner and its only a short walk to catch many of the other trains. You are also within walking distance of Soho which offers lots of cool places to eat and shop. The hotel its self is very nice, still looks new. The rooms are a decent size and there is minimal noise from the street. The huge floor to ceiling windows are also very nice.
